We have designed a C++ class framework for handling optimization problems
involving linear operators. The use of C++ has enabled us to separate
the task of writing procedural operators from the task of writing
routines to solve the optimization problems. This separation was not
possible in Fortran and we were limited in the type of problems we
could solve in Fortran because of the growing complexity of the code.
The encapsulation of the concepts of linear operators and spaces in
concrete C++ classes enable authors to deal with problems at a
much higher level than in Fortran.
The error checking built into the base operator and space classes is a valuable
aid to writing new code and prevents many of the trivial book-keeping errors
that occur when writing in Fortran.
